ULSTER COUNTY GRAND JURY INDICTS KINGSTON WOMAN FOR ACCIDENT THAT KILLED BICYCLIST

Posted April 7, 2025

Kingston, NY—The Ulster County District Attorney’s Office announced the indictment and arrest of Vanessa Lowe, age 62, of Kingston, NY. An Ulster County Grand Jury indicted Lowe on charges of Vehicular Manslaughter in the Second Degree, Assault in the Second Degree, and Driving While Ability Impaired by Drugs in connection with a fatal bicyclist accident which resulted in the death of 65-year-old Kingston resident Christine Tarasco on December 27, 2022.

A warrant of arrest was issued by the Ulster County Court on April 3, 2025. Kingston Police Department arrested Lowe the same day.

The indictment is in connection to a vehicular accident on December 27, 2022 at 3:37 p.m., on Pine Grove Avenue in the City of Kingston. Lowe struck bicyclist Christine Tarasco with her 2008 Honda Accord. EMS was able to revive Tarasco and transported her to HealthAlliance Hospital in Kingston where she died from her injuries.

An investigation was subsequently conducted by the Kingston Police Department and the Ulster County DA’s Office. Toxicology reports of Lowe’s blood revealed controlled substances in her system at the time of the accident.

Lowe was arraigned on April 4, 2025, before the Honorable James Farrell; she was remanded to the Ulster County Jail on $50,000 cash, $100,000 bond, and $500,000 partially secured bond. 

Assistant District Attorney Victoria Lang is prosecuting the case. Defendant is represented by Office of the Ulster County Public Defender.

The defendant is presumed innocent unless and until proven guilty in court.
